Test-Driven Development
Na co se můžete těšit:
Chtěli byste pracovat s kódem, do kterého se nebojíte sáhnout? Kódem, která se snadno refaktoruje, protože máte tolik unit testů, které vám okamžitě řeknou, když uděláte něco špatně? Kódem, který neobsahuje žádné známé chyby? Řeknu vám příběh týmu, který žije takto, protože jejich pokrytí unit testy je přes 96 % a roste. Magickou ingrediencí je Test-Driven Development (TDD) - psaní testů společně s kódem v mikro-inkrementech, které trvají maximálně několik minut. Ukážu vám, co je TDD (včetně skutečného kódování) a jak se aplikuje ve zmíněném týmu na tech stack python/django. Budu mluvit o reálných zkušenostech, výhodách, které TDD přináší, a současných výzvách.
Prezentující: Robert Batůšek
Je konzultant vývoje software s více než dvacetiletou zkušeností v oboru, trenér LeSSu (jediný v ČR) a programátor. Ve firmách si prošel mnoha pozicemi od vývojáře přes architekta, projektového manažera, vedoucího týmu, manažera až po Scrum Mastera a agilního kouče. V několika firmách měl možnost zavést a vylepšit agilní produktový vývoj ve velkém měřítku (30 a více týmů). Firmám pomáhá zejména zjednodušit produktový vývoj ve více týmech tak, aby se dokázal rychle přizpůsobit měnícím se prioritám byznysu a přitom firma neztratila schopnost růst. Jako programátor je propagátorem Test-Driven Developmentu, protože dobře ví, že tato technika výrazně snižuje množství chyb v produkci.
Místo konání:
V současné době jsme se Vám rozhodli poskytnout snídani ve virtuální podobě. Den před konáním Vám zašleme na emailovou adresu link pro připojení.
Těšíme se na Vaši účast, team DataScriptu
Podmínky registrace
Podmínkou bezplatné účasti na našich snídaních je uvedení Vaší společnosti, jmenného emailu a platného telefonního čísla. V opačném případě si vyhrazujeme právo Vaši účast odmítnout.